Akan-Mashu National Park is located in Japan's northernmost prefecture of Hokkaido. It's home to Lake Akan, Lake Kussharo and Lake Mashu, 3 unique lakes formed by repeated volcanic activity. Join us as we take in its stunning winter sights and learn about the indigenous Ainu culture, which was influenced by the surrounding nature.